> Eric suggested/uses this format (thanks for sharing, Eric): > [[cite:jones-etal-2000][Jones et al., 2000]] > 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 > key displayed in org I'd suggest to treat org-link-abbrev-alist and locally defined abbreviated links differently when opening the link at point and when exporting the buffer. At expand time, the exporter could attach a list of export functions (filters?) to the expanded link, depending on the local setting for the abbreviated link or `org-link-abbrev-alist'. For example: #+LINK: cite file:my.bib::%s org-latex-bibtex-link (setq org-link-abbrev-alist '(("cite" "file:my.bib::%s" 'org-latex-bibtex-link))) Then org-latex-bibtex-link would internally find the link, process the BibTeX entry and return a sensible \cite{...} string.
